Hadith text

Original Arabic

قَرَأْتُ عَلَى عَبْدِ الرَّحْمَنِ: مَالِكٌ، وَحَدَّثَنَا إِسْحَاقُ، أَخْبَرَنِي مَالِكٌ، عَنْ نُعَيْمِ بْنِ عَبْدِ اللهِ الْمُجْمِرِ، أَنَّ مُحَمَّدَ بْنَ عَبْدِ اللهِ بْنِ زَيْدٍ الْأَنْصَارِيَّ فِي حَدِيثِ عَبْدِ الرَّحْمَنِ وَعَبْدُ اللهِ بْنُ زَيْدٍ هُوَ الَّذِي كَانَ أُرِيَ النِّدَاءَ بِالصَّلَاةِ أَخْبَرَهُ، عَنْ أَبِي مَسْعُودٍ الْأَنْصَارِيِّ أَنَّهُ قَالَ: أَتَانَا رَسُولُ اللهِ صَلَّى الله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 فِي مَجْلِسِ سَعْدِ بْنِ عُبَادَةَ فَقَالَ لَهُ بَشِيرُ بْنُ سَعْدٍ: أَمَرَنَا اللهُ أَنْ نُصَلِّيَ عَلَيْكَ يَا رَسُولَ اللهِ فَكَيْفَ نُصَلِّي عَلَيْكَ؟ قَالَ: فَسَكَتَ رَسُولُ اللهِ صَلَّى الله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 حَتَّى تَمَنَّيْنَا أَنَّهُ لَمْ يَسْأَلْهُ، ثُمَّ قَالَ: قُولُوا: " اللهُمَّ صَلِّ عَلَى مُحَمَّدٍ وَعَلَى آلِ مُحَمَّدٍ كَمَا صَلَّيْتَ عَلَى إِبْرَاهِيمَ، وَبَارِكْ عَلَى مُحَمَّدٍ وَعَلَى آلِ مُحَمَّدٍ كَمَا بَارَكْتَ عَلَى آلِ إِبْرَاهِيمَ فِي الْعَالَمِينَ إِنَّكَ حَمِيدٌ مَجِيدٌ، وَالسَّلَامُ كَمَا قَدْ عَلِمْتُمْ " (٢)، ،

Translation

English translation

It is narrated from Abu Mas’ud (may Allah be pleased with him) that once the Prophet Muhammad (ﷺ) came to us while we were in the gathering of Sa’d bin ‘Ubadah (may Allah be pleased with him). Bashir bin Sa’d (may Allah be pleased with him) submitted in the presence of the Messenger of Allah, “O Messenger of Allah! Allah Almighty has commanded us to send blessings upon you. How should we send blessings upon you?” The Prophet Muhammad (ﷺ) remained silent for so long that we wished we had not asked this question. Then he said, “Say: ‘O Allah, send blessings upon Muhammad and upon the family of Muhammad as You sent blessings upon Ibrahim, and bless Muhammad as You blessed the family of Ibrahim. Indeed, You are Praiseworthy, Glorious.’ And as for the words of salam (peace), you already know them.”

This is Hadith 22352 in Musnad Ahmad. It appears in Book 990, Hadith of Abu Mas'ud Uqbah ibn Amr al-Ansari (may Allah be pleased with him), as in-book entry 14.
